(U.S. Patent No. 5,866,066)
Nominal Analysis
0.25 C, 2.40 Cr, 11.0 Ni, 1.40 Mo, 15.0 Co, Bal. Fe
AerMet 310 alloy possesses higher hardness
and strength than AerMet 100 alloy
while maintaining exceptional ductility and toughness. At a 310 ksi (2137 MPa)
ultimate tensile strength, AerMet 310 alloy exhibits toughness values equivalent
to alloys 20 ksi (138 MPa) lower in strength. The alloy should be considered
as a candidate for use in components requiring high strength, high fracture
toughness and exceptional resistance to stress corrosion cracking and fatigue.
